Vapor Pressureo Dfns.
▫ pres. of vapor present above a (l) or (s)
▫ Hvap energy to convert 1 mole liquid to gas at 1 atm
o Eq. Vapor Pressure▫ rate of evaporation =
rate of condensationo Measuring Pvapor
▫ Hg columnPvapor = Patm – PHg column
